In this episode, host Michael Marchuk talks with Jonathan Porter-Whistman, CEO of Perception Predict. Jonathan discusses the importance of applying data-driven analytics to the hiring process and building better teams and highlights the lack of AI and automation in HR compared to other areas of business and emphasizes the need for organizations to adapt to the introduction of new resources. Jonathan also explains how organizations can build the right talent by fostering curiosity and mental flexibility. He also explores the impact of technology on job roles and the importance of creating a culture that encourages growth and mobility as well as the changing dynamics of employee tenure and the role of generational differences in organizational thinking. Here’s what we talked with Jonathan about:  - Applying data-driven analytics to the hiring process to build better teams. - Adapting to the introduction of new resources, such as AI and automation, in order to build the right talent. - Fostering curiosity and mental flexibility in employees to navigate the changing job landscape. - Creating a culture that encourages growth, mobility, and the exploration of new technologies.
